如何在大数据可视化引擎中实现数据聚合?
在大数据时代,数据已经成为企业、政府和各类组织的重要资产。如何高效地处理和分析这些海量数据,提取有价值的信息,成为了当今信息技术领域的一大挑战。大数据可视化引擎作为一种高效的数据分析工具,能够将复杂的数据转化为直观的图形和图表,帮助用户快速理解数据背后的规律。本文将深入探讨如何在大数据可视化引擎中实现数据聚合,以期为相关从业人员提供参考。
一、数据聚合的概念
数据聚合是指将多个数据源中的数据按照一定的规则进行整合、合并,形成一个新的数据集的过程。在大数据可视化引擎中,数据聚合是数据处理和分析的重要环节,它可以帮助用户从海量数据中提取出有价值的信息,为决策提供依据。
二、数据聚合的方法
- 数据清洗
在进行数据聚合之前,首先要对原始数据进行清洗。数据清洗包括以下步骤:
- 缺失值处理:对缺失数据进行填充或删除。
- 异常值处理:识别并处理异常数据,如数据录入错误、数据采集错误等。
- 数据转换:将不同格式的数据转换为统一的格式。
- 数据整合
数据整合是指将来自不同数据源的数据按照一定的规则进行合并。常见的数据整合方法包括:
- 表连接:通过连接两个或多个表中的共同字段,将数据合并成一个新表。
- 数据透视:按照特定的维度对数据进行分组和汇总,形成新的数据表。
- 数据转换
数据转换是指将数据从一种格式转换为另一种格式。常见的数据转换方法包括:
- 数据类型转换:将数值型数据转换为字符串型数据,或将字符串型数据转换为数值型数据。
- 数据格式转换:将日期时间型数据转换为不同的日期时间格式。
- 数据聚合
数据聚合是指对数据进行分组、汇总和计算。常见的数据聚合方法包括:
- 分组:按照特定的维度对数据进行分组,如按照地区、时间、产品等分组。
- 汇总:对分组后的数据进行求和、平均值、最大值、最小值等计算。
- 计算:对数据进行复杂的计算,如计算增长率、相关性等。
三、数据聚合的案例分析
以某电商平台为例,假设我们需要分析不同地区的用户购买行为。以下是数据聚合的过程:
数据清洗:对用户数据、订单数据、商品数据进行清洗,处理缺失值、异常值和数据格式。
数据整合:通过表连接将用户数据、订单数据、商品数据整合成一个新表。
数据转换:将日期时间型数据转换为统一的日期时间格式。
数据聚合:
- 按照地区分组,计算每个地区的订单数量、销售额、用户数量等指标。
- 按照商品类别分组,计算每个类别的订单数量、销售额、用户数量等指标。
- 计算不同地区、不同商品类别的订单增长率、用户增长率等指标。
通过数据聚合,我们可以直观地了解不同地区、不同商品类别的用户购买行为,为优化产品、提升销售业绩提供依据。
四、总结
在大数据可视化引擎中实现数据聚合是数据处理和分析的重要环节。通过对数据进行清洗、整合、转换和聚合,我们可以从海量数据中提取有价值的信息,为决策提供依据。本文介绍了数据聚合的概念、方法和案例分析,希望对相关从业人员有所帮助。在实际应用中,根据具体需求选择合适的数据聚合方法,才能更好地发挥大数据可视化引擎的作用。
猜你喜欢:云网监控平台